About this program

Since 1989, Irvington Neighborhood Improvement Corporation (INIC) has been designated as the Social Service Agency to provide community resource and referral services for the Township of Irvington. INIC’s mission is to address the needs of individuals and families at or below the poverty level. INIC receives funding for programs such as Social Services for the Homeless and Temporary Assistance for Needy Families under the Community Service Block Grant through Essex County Division of Community Action. In addition, we receive funding from the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) for a Transitional Housing Program for homeless families.
Services offered
Emergency Relocation Assistance; Utility Assistance; Rental Arrears; Emergency Food Assistance (referrals); Transitional Housing; Holiday & Back to School Giveaways; Soup Kitchen
